Water also hot or too chilly
Every hot water heater has a thermostat that establishes exactly how warm the water obtains. If the water entering your residence is as well hot in spite of establishing a practical optimum temperature level, your thermostat might be malfunctioning.
On the other hand, also cold water may result from a failed thermostat, a damaged circuit, or incorrect gas flow. As an example, if you make use of a gas water heater with a broken pilot light, you would obtain cold water, even if the thermostat is in ideal condition. For electrical heaters, a blown fuse might be the wrongdoer.

Unusual noises
There are at the very least 5 kinds of sounds you can hear from a water heater, but one of the most common interpretation is that it's time for the water heater to retire.
To start with, you must recognize with the typical sounds a water heater makes. An electric heating system may seem different from a gas-powered one.
Popping or banging sounds generally indicate there is a piece of sediment in your storage tanks, and it's time to cleanse it out. On the other hand, whistling or hissing noises might simply be your valves letting some stress off.
Water leakages
Leakages could come from pipes, water links, valves, or in the worst-case situation, the storage tank itself. Gradually, water will certainly wear away the container, and also locate its escape. If this takes place, you require to replace your water heater as soon as possible.
However, prior to your adjustment your entire container, make certain that all pipelines remain in location and that each shutoff functions completely. If you still need assistance identifying a leakage, call your plumber.

Warm water
Regardless of just how high you set the thermostat, you will not obtain any type of warm water out of a heating unit well past its prime. A hot water heater's effectiveness might lower with time.
You will additionally obtain warm water if your pipes have a cross connection. This suggests that when you activate a faucet, warm water from the heating unit streams in along with routine, cold water. A cross connection is very easy to place. If your warm water faucets still run after closing the hot water heater shutoffs, you have a cross link.
Discoloured Water
Rust is a major root cause of filthy or discoloured water. Rust within the water storage tank or a falling short anode pole can create this discolouration. The anode pole shields the container from rusting on the within as well as ought to be examined annual. Without a rod or a properly operating anode pole, the warm water promptly rusts inside the container. Call an expert water heater service technician to figure out if changing the anode pole will repair the issue; otherwise, change your hot water heater.

The Water Heater Is Leaking
A leaky cold water inlet valve A loose pipe fitting A leaky temperature and pressure relief valve A corroded anode rod A cracked tank Turn Off Your Water Heater:
Shut off your gas water heater by turning the gas valve on the unit to the “OFF” position. Shut off your electric water by switching its power off at your electrical panel. Look for a two-pole breaker labeled “water heater” and turn it to the “OFF” position. Move the ball valve connected to the water heater to be perpendicular to the piping at a 90° angle. Look for the Leak:
Depending on whether the water is coming from the tank's top or bottom, you’ll want to look for the leak in different locations.
If the leak comes from the top of the tank, carefully look for water escaping from the cold water inlet valve or loose pipe fittings. Rusted hot and cold water valves can have loose connections with the tank, with water leaking out of them.
